Fructose-1,6-diphosphate Usage
Suitable for a variety of symptoms caused by cardiac ischemia for coronary heart disease, angina, acute myocardial infarction, heart failure and arrhythmia adjuvant therapy. In recent years, also used for myocardial injury caused by hyperkalemia, acute adult respiratory distress syndrome, dilated cardiomyopathy, parenteral nutrition, cardiopulmonary bypass heart surgery as adjuvant therapy, has a good effect. Can accelerate alcohol metabolism, for the adjuvant treatment of acute poisoning. Fructose can be used to supplement the heat diabetes, because fructose does not require insulin into glycogen in the liver or metabolic decomposition. In addition they can accelerate the metabolism of ethanol, can be used for the treatment of acute alcohol poisoning. Although it is part of the body can be converted into glucose, but not for hypoglycemia.

Polyglutamic acid (y-PGA), also known as natto gum, is a high molecular peptide polymer synthesized from several glutamic acid monomers through microbial fermentation. It is rich in glutamic acid, glucose, protein and minerals. , vitamins and other biologically active substances.
Polyglutamic acid (??-PGA) is a sticky substance that was first discovered in ??Natto??. It is currently widely used in agricultural production and is called a new biostimulant. It is fully water-soluble, biodegradable, edible, and non-toxic. It is a biopolymer produced by microbial fermentation.

Coenzyme A sodium salt hydrate (CAS 55672-92-9) is an important biologically active substance.
Appearance: Usually white or off-white powder. Solubility: Easily soluble in water, forming a clear solution in water.
Function: In the body, coenzyme A sodium salt hydrate is an important coenzyme that participates in a variety of biochemical reactions. It plays a key role in the metabolism of fatty acids, promoting the activation and oxidative decomposition of fatty acids. It participates in the tricarboxylic acid cycle and provides energy for cells. It is also important for the metabolism of certain amino acids.
Application: Commonly used in biochemistry and molecular biology research as a cofactor for enzyme reactions.
In the field of medicine, it may be used in the treatment or adjuvant treatment of certain diseases.
